Tag: mental disorder


#MHJ Explaining My ADHD with Memes

Meme: an amusing or interesting item (such as a captioned picture or video) or genre of items that is spread widely online especially through social media. - Merriam-Webster Dictionary Online
Mental Health

#MHJ 8. Meds Check-Ins

Three out of 5 of my former and current prescribed daily pills are classified as psychotropics here in Indonesia. Here's a review for how they helped me and my mental health.